delivering

Pronunciation: [dɪˈlɪvərɪŋ]

Word

Context: "transportation"

(verb) to bring something to a specific place or person. When you take a package or message to someone, you are delivering it.

Example

The delivery person is delivering a package to our house right now.

Example

They are not delivering our pizza because the restaurant is closed.

Example

Is the mailman delivering the letters today?

Context: "performance"

(verb) to present or give a speech, message, or performance to an audience. It’s like when someone tells a story, a speech, or sings in front of people.

Example

She is delivering a wonderful speech about kindness at the school assembly.

Example

He wasn't delivering his message clearly, and many people were confused.

Example

What message are you delivering to the audience today?

Context: "childbirth"

(verb) to help a baby be born. When a mother is bringing a baby into the world, doctors and nurses are involved in delivering the baby.

Example

The doctor was delivering a baby when the phone rang.

Example

Unfortunately, she wasn’t able to be there for delivering her baby.

Example

Is the nurse helping with delivering the baby?
